  1. Adagio is a 2023 Italian crime drama film directed by Stefano Sollima from a screenplay by Sollima and Stefano Bises , and starring Pierfrancesco Favino, Toni Servillo and Valerio Mastandrea. The film concludes Sollima's trilogy about crime in Rome (preceded by ACAB (2012) and Suburra (2015)).
